Chitral

Chitral is a mountainous region in northern Pakistan, part of the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province. Known for its stunning landscapes, it features rugged peaks, lush valleys, and the historic Chitral Fort. The area is home to the unique Kalash Valley, inhabited by the Kalash people, who have distinct cultural traditions and languages. Chitral is accessible mainly through mountain passes and is famous for its diverse wildlife, including ibex and snow leopards. It combines natural beauty, rich history, and diverse cultures, making it a significant destination for travelers and a vital part of Pakistan's northern frontier.
